WebDec 6, 2024 · How to Improve Your English Spelling: 9 Painless Methods. 1. Use mnemonics. Remembering information can be difficult. But when you give that information more meaning, it becomes easier to memorize. Mnemonic devices turn information into a picture, a sentence, a rhyme or anything else that’s easier to remember. Webtenant 1 of 2 noun ten· ant ˈten-ənt 1 : one who occupies property of another especially for rent 2 : occupant tenant 2 of 2 verb : to hold or occupy as a tenant : inhabit Legal Definition tenant noun ten· ant ˈte-nənt : one who holds or possesses property by any kind of right : …

Both words, tenant and tenet, derive from the Latin verb tenere, “to hold,” but they are not interchangeable.
